How far down the White River can you catch trout?
Our fishery starts below Bull Shoals Dam and continues 100 miles or so downstream. The North Fork River injects freshly cooled and oxygenated water into the White about 35 or 40 miles downstream enabling trout to survive well below these great dams.
Do you need a trout stamp to fish White River Arkansas?
You need fishing license for trout fishing in Arkansas. White River trout fishing requires a trout stamp, or trout license for fishing.
What is the best time to trout fish in Arkansas?
November is a great time to fish for trout, particularly on the White River below Bull Shoals and Norfork dams, where brown trout make their spawning runs. Or, look for blue catfish on the Mississippi River.

How deep is the White River in Arkansas?
Through the Boston Mountains and the Ozark Plateau of southern Missouri, the White River is deeply entrenched in narrow gorges; much of its middle course is a valley more than 500 feet (150 m) deep.

How much does a trout stamp cost in Arkansas?
The act will increase the cost of Arkansas’s resident trout stamp from $5 to $10, with the additional proceeds devoted to trout management and hatcheries in the state.

Where is the best place to trout fish in Arkansas?
Trout Waters The White River is one of the most popular trout streams, particularly below Bull Shoals Dam and on the North Fork of the White River below Norfork Dam. The Little Red River below Greers Ferry Dam is another hot spot. Anglers hit the waters with fly rods or spinning rods, wading or fishing from a boat.
